3.List the input and output components for the process of making artificial satellite
Solution
Input Components for the process of making an artificial satellite:
-
Design and Planning: This includes the initial concept, purpose, and functionality of the satellite. It also involves deciding on the type of orbit and lifespan.
-
Materials: These are the physical components used to build the satellite, such as metals, composites, and electronic components.
-
Manufacturing Equipment: This includes the machinery and tools used to assemble the satellite.
-
Testing Equipment: Before launch, satellites undergo rigorous testing to ensure they can withstand the harsh conditions of space.
-
Human Resources: This includes the engineers, technicians, scientists, and other personnel involved in the design, construction, testing, and launch of the satellite.
-
Launch Vehicle: This is the rocket that will carry the satellite into space.
Output Components for the process of making an artificial satellite:
-
Completed Satellite: The final product, ready for launch.
-
Data: Once in orbit, the satellite will start to generate data, which can be used for various purposes such as weather forecasting, GPS, communication, research, etc.
-
Waste: The manufacturing process will produce waste materials, which need to be disposed of properly.
-
Knowledge and Experience: The process of building and launching a satellite contributes to our understanding of space technology and can lead to advancements in the field.
